I checked with them a few months ago on a set with an American Flag and Eagle. If I remember correctly they quoted over $600.00 for the set. I think they provided a new set of FRC's and the design I was looking at was fairly complex. All in all I didn't think their price was out of line for what they we going to do. I ended up doing something else, but I will definitely give them the business when I get ready.

Go to their website take a look at some of the examples they have posted and e-mail them for a quote.
